@font-face{font-family:"Programme";src:url("subset-Programme-Regular.woff") format("woff");font-weight:normal;font-style:normal}body{margin:0;padding:0}span{display:inline-block;margin-top:-4px}.ad-container{box-sizing:border-box;border:1px solid #000;position:relative;background-color:#4267b2;color:#fff;font-family:"Programme";font-size:31px;user-select:none;overflow:hidden}.preload-img{opacity:0;width:1px;height:1px}.font-detector{position:absolute;left:0;top:0;opacity:0}.font-detector.fallback{font-family:"Arial"}.font-detector.custom{font-family:"Programme"}.click-area{position:absolute;width:100%;height:100%;z-index:3;cursor:pointer;top:0;left:0}.typed-paragraph{letter-spacing:.5px;position:relative;line-height:1.08}.typed-word{position:relative;display:inline-block;margin-right:10px;z-index:1;vertical-align:top}.typed-letter{position:relative;opacity:0}.cursor{position:absolute;background-color:#4081fd;width:3px;height:30px;left:0;top:0;z-index:0}.animated-border{position:absolute}.animated-border .border{position:absolute;background-color:#4081fd}.animated-chat-box{position:absolute}.animated-chat-box .tail-container{position:absolute;width:20px;height:0;overflow:hidden}.animated-chat-box .tail-container.left{position:absolute;width:0;height:20px;overflow:hidden;left:-10px;top:29px}.animated-chat-box .tail{line-height:0;width:0;height:0;border-style:solid;border-width:0 10px 10px 10px;border-color:transparent transparent #fff transparent}.animated-chat-box .tail.left{line-height:0;width:0;height:0;border-style:solid;border-width:10px 10px 10px 0;border-color:transparent #fff transparent transparent}.animated-chat-box .box{position:absolute;background-color:#fff;border-radius:5px;overflow:hidden}.animated-chat-box .line-container{position:absolute;width:46%;height:14px;overflow:hidden}.animated-chat-box .line-container:nth-child(even){left:46%}.animated-chat-box .line-container .check{opacity:0;position:absolute;width:14px;height:14px;left:12px;background-image:url("circle-check_25x25.png");background-position:center;background-repeat:no-repeat;background-size:contain}.animated-chat-box .line-container .line{opacity:0;position:absolute;background-color:#4081fd;height:2px;width:45px;left:35px;top:7px}.letter-swap{background-position:bottom;background-repeat:no-repeat}.down-arrow{position:absolute;width:24px;height:0;left:89px;top:72px;background-image:url(blue-arrow_50x50.png);background-position:center;background-repeat:no-repeat;background-size:contain}.p1.animate-in{animation-name:p1-start;animation-duration:.6s;animation-fill-mode:forwards;animation-timing-function:ease}.fb-logo-sm.animate-in{animation-name:logo-sm-start;animation-duration:.5s;animation-fill-mode:forwards;animation-timing-function:ease}.fb-logo-sm.animate-out{animation-name:logo-sm-exit;animation-duration:.45s;animation-fill-mode:forwards;animation-timing-function:ease}.fb-logo-lg.animate-in{animation-name:logo-lg-start;animation-duration:.5s;animation-fill-mode:forwards;animation-timing-function:ease}.fb-logo-lg.animate-up{animation-name:logo-lg-up;animation-duration:.5s;animation-fill-mode:forwards;animation-timing-function:ease}.cta-btn.animate-up{animation-name:cta-btn-up;animation-duration:.425s;animation-fill-mode:forwards;animation-timing-function:ease}.replay-btn{display:flex;align-items:center;position:absolute;bottom:7px;left:10px;z-index:4;cursor:pointer}.replay-btn svg{width:12px;height:12px;padding-left:1px;padding-top:2px;transform:scale(1.3);transition:transform .4s cubic-bezier(0.86,0,0.07,1);transform-origin:center}.replay-btn:hover svg{transform:scale(1.3) rotate(180deg)}.replay-btn .img-wrap{margin-top:-4px;margin-left:6px;opacity:0;transition:all .4s cubic-bezier(0.86,0,0.07,1);transform:translateX(-7px)}.replay-btn:hover .img-wrap{opacity:1;transform:translateX(0)}.replay-btn img{height:11px}.replay-btn.animate-in{animation:replay-in .5s forwards}@keyframes replay-in{0%{opacity:0}100%{opacity:1}}